What is an entry level biochemistry job?
An Entry Level Biochemistry job typically involves assisting in laboratory research, conducting experiments, analyzing biological samples, and documenting findings. These positions are common in industries like pharmaceuticals, biotechnology, healthcare, and environmental science. Responsibilities may include preparing lab materials, following protocols, and supporting senior scientists in their research. Str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and a foundation in chemistry and biology are essential. Many entry-level roles require a bachelor's degree in biochemistry or a related field.
What types of projects or tasks can I expect to work on as an entry level biochemist?
As an entry level biochemist, you can expect to be involved in tasks such as preparing chemical solutions, conducting experiments, analyzing data, and maintaining laboratory equipment. You may assist senior scientists with ongoing research projects, perform standard assays, and document experimental results for review. Entry level roles often involve both routine laboratory work and learning new protocols, providing valuable hands-on experience. You'll typically work within a collaborative team environment, giving you the opportunity to learn from experienced colleagues and contribute to larger research objectives.
What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the entry level biochemistry position, and why are they important?
To thrive as an Entry Level Biochemistry professional, a solid foundation in biochemistry, molecular biology, and laboratory techniques—supported by at least a bachelor's degree in a related field—is essential. Familiarity with tools such as PCR machines, spectrophotometers, chromatography systems, and analytical software is commonly expected. Attention to detail, strong organizational skills, and the ability to work both independently and as part of a team help candidates stand out. These skills ensure accuracy in experimental work, efficient lab operations, and effective collaboration within scientific teams.

Job description
Position Summary
The Analytical Data Review Scientist is responsible for analyzing, tracking, and reporting laboratory and business data to support Eagle Analytical’s operations, quality, and compliance objectives. This role combines data analytics, programming, and business intelligence with hands-on laboratory testing support, ensuring timely and accurate sample testing, data management, and documentation. The position requires technical expertise in data analytics, relational databases, and data visualization, as well as a strong understanding of laboratory processes, SOP compliance, and quality standards.
What You Will Do
- Review analytical data, chromatographic reports, calculations, and laboratory worksheets for completeness, accuracy, and compliance with cGMP, cGLP, ISO 17025, USP, A2LA, and internal SOPs.
- Electronically sign off on data as both author and reviewer, following established procedures to ensure data integrity and regulatory compliance.
- Perform technical review and approval of Out-of-Specification (OOS) and Out-of-Trend (OOT) investigations, ensuring results meet regulatory and quality standards prior to release.
- Maintain accurate and current documentation of laboratory activities, SOPs, and forms.
- Write, revise, and review SOPs and related forms in a timely manner as required.
- Support laboratory compliance audits, internal quality audits, and safety audits.
- Participate in investigations of deviations, errors, and discrepancies, and assist with CAPA plans and risk assessments.
- Communicate with laboratory staff to proactively address documentation quality and resolve deficiencies.
- Perform routine and non-routine chemical analyses using HPLC, UPLC, GC, and spectrophotometry, as needed, under limited supervision.
- Process raw data using laboratory information management systems (e.g., EagleTrax, Empower) and ensure proper documentation and traceability.
- Perform routine testing on samples in a timely manner, tracking and meeting assigned deadlines.
- Notify supervisors promptly of unexpected test results and provide initial problem-solving with minimal supervision.
- Perform maintenance, calibration, and troubleshooting of assigned laboratory equipment and systems; report calibration failures or repair needs promptly.
- Maintain familiarity with all applicable laboratory equipment, systems, and SOPs.
- Assist across workstations as needed, providing backup support for all laboratory functions.
- Maintain clean, orderly, and safe laboratory work areas while observing personal safety protocols.
- Process and analyze data to generate reports to support laboratory operations, quality review activities, and timely release of results to clients and internal stakeholders.
- Provide consultative support to customers regarding technical questions related to testing, methods, or analytical results.
- Participate in team discussions and contribute to achieving laboratory goals.
- Stay current with emerging technology, instruments, and regulatory changes, with emphasis on HPLC and pharmaceutical analytical chemistry applications.
- Assist in training new hires in entry-level or laboratory support positions.
- Perform other duties and special projects assigned to support laboratory and quality operations.
Who You Are
Bachelor’s or Master’s degree in Chemistry, Analytical Chemistry, Biochemistry, or a related science field.
Minimum 2 years’ experience in a regulated pharmaceutical analytical laboratory, or equivalent combination of education and experience.
Proficiency with analytical instruments (HPLC, UPLC, GC, UV/Vis spectrophotometer), including operation, troubleshooting, and maintenance.
Experience with LIMS (e.g., Empower, EagleTrax) and electronic data review.
Strong knowledge of cGMP, cGLP, ISO 17025, USP, A2LA, and data integrity principles.
Experience with laboratory documentation, technical review of analytical data, and OOS/OOT investigations.
Excellent attention to detail, organizational, and communication skills; ability to work independently and collaboratively.
Proficiency in Microsoft Office.
Experience with method development, validation, and transfer; familiarity with regulatory submissions and quality systems.
Exposure to multiple laboratory workstations, cross-functional operations, and providing technical consultation is a plus.
Knowledge of emerging analytical technologies and pharmaceutical testing applications.
